KTM RC 390 bolt-on Racing kit for Rs 20,000 – Fine tuned by Sarge

Pune based Autologue Design has given the KTM RC390 a makeover, which will be appreciated by those into track racing. The design firm has fitted the RC390 with a track focused race kit called RCX2. Autologue Design has worked along with ace racer Sagar Sheldekar, aka Sarge.

The exclusive bolt-on KTM RC390 kit includes front fairing with a large bubble visor, headlamp covers, side panels and a sleek tail segment. The bike is also seen with shorter engine belly cover, roomier seats and aerodynamic fairing offering reduced wind drag. Buyers can either select the entire kit or opt for individual parts according to their requirements.

Autologue Design has priced the RCX2 race kit at Rs 20,000 for pre orders while following the pre-order period, the same kit will be available for Rs 25,000. This is the second kit offered by the company following the KTM RCX kit also for the RC 390. The RCX2 race kit includes only cosmetic updates and race inspired kit while no changes are made to mechanics.

Speaking about the special racing kit, Pune’s Autologue Design has thoroughly tested the kit on a racing track. And riding the bike on test was Sarge, who was a former test rider and host at Powerdrift. As per Autologue, this kit is perfect those KTM RC 390 owners who like to race their bikes on a race track. Not only the improved aerodynamics help in achieving higher top speed, you can also lean better thanks to the custom engine belly.

Stock KTM RC390, priced at Rs 2.6 lakhs, sports upside down forks in the front and preload adjustable monoshock at the rear. It sits on 17” alloy wheels fitted with high performance Metzeler Sportec M5 tyres.

The bike also receives cast aluminum swing arm, a digital instrument cluster and projector headlamps. It gets its power via a 373.3cc, single cylinder, 4 valve, liquid cooled, fuel injected engine offering 43 bhp power at 9,000 rpm and 36 Nm torque at 7,000 rpm mated to a 6 speed transmission.
